Drupal

T&J untuk pengembang dan administrator Drupal


4
Cara mendapatkan URL dasar suatu situs
Situs saya ada di http: //drupal8.local/ . Bagaimana saya mendapatkan bagian drupal8.local dari URL itu? Url::fromRoute('<'current'>')atau base_path()mengembalikan bagian path dari URL; Misalnya, untuk http: //drupal8.local/a/b/c/d/e/f , mereka mengembalikan ' /a/b/c/d/e/f'ketika saya hanya perlu mendapatkannya 'drupal8.local'. Bagaimana saya bisa mendapatkan bagian dari URL itu?
34 8  uri 

1
Untuk apa $ form_state digunakan?
Apa yang $form_statebiasanya digunakan dalam konteks API Formulir jika digunakan sebagai argumen? Secara khusus, saya mencari contoh kapan digunakan.
33 forms 


3
Bagaimana cara saya mengelompokkan elemen dalam tampilan?
Saya memiliki 8 artikel: Artikel 1 (Permainan), Pasal 2 (Berita Lokal), Pasal 3 (Berita Dunia), Pasal 4 (Berita Dunia), Pasal 5 (Permainan), Pasal 6, Pasal 7, Pasal 8. Dalam pandangan saya ingin mengelompokkan artikel berdasarkan: "Berita," "Game," dan "Lainnya." Menggabungkan dunia dan berita lokal di bawah satu kategori, dan memindahkan …
33 7  views 

6
Jenis serangan apa yang dicegah oleh patch untuk SA-CORE-2014-005 (Drupal 7.32)?
Membaca di https://www.drupal.org/node/2357241 dan rincian teknis di https://www.drupal.org/SA-CORE-2014-005 , serta tambalan aktual yang sederhana: diff --git a/includes/database/database.inc b/includes/database/database.inc index f78098b..01b6385 100644 --- a/includes/database/database.inc +++ b/includes/database/database.inc @@ -736,7 +736,7 @@ abstract class DatabaseConnection extends PDO { // to expand it out into a comma-delimited set of placeholders. foreach (array_filter($args, 'is_array') as …
33 security 



6
Bagaimana cara memperbarui konfigurasi modul?
Saya sedang membangun modul khusus di Drupal 8. Ini mencakup beberapa file konfigurasi YAML. Ketika saya mengembangkan saya perlu mengubah dan menambahkan ke konfigurasi, misalnya untuk menambah bidang lain ke entitas kustom saya. Saat ini satu-satunya cara yang saya temukan untuk membuat Drupal memperhatikan perubahannya adalah mencopot modul dan menginstalnya …

9
Bagaimana saya bisa menampilkan blok secara terprogram?
Saya mengembangkan situs menggunakan Drupal 8 beta-14. Saya telah membuat blok tampilan istilah yang berbeda dan sekarang saya ingin menampilkannya menggunakan kode. Bagaimana saya bisa menampilkannya secara terprogram? Saya dulu melakukannya di Drupal 7 menggunakan kode ini, tetapi saya bingung tentang Drupal 8. $block = module_invoke('block', 'block_view', '4'); $text_block = …
33 8  blocks 

5
Bagaimana cara mendapatkan istilah taksonomi dari tid?
Banyak barang-barang kami telah diformat seperti uris site/taxonomy/XX, di mana XX adalah bilangan bulat. Saya menemukan banyak pertanyaan seperti " bagaimana cara mendapatkan TID dari namanya? ", Tetapi saya ingin mendapatkan namanya dari TID. Saya mencoba menyusun skrip remah roti dan semuanya bagus kecuali untuk kasus ini di mana saya …
32 7  taxonomy-terms 

6
Secara terprogram membuat istilah?
Saya mencoba untuk menambahkan banyak istilah (~ 200) ke kosakata, tetapi saya tidak dapat menemukan modul impor yang diperbarui untuk Drupal 8, dan sepertinya fungsi untuk melakukan ini di Drupal 7 tidak ada di Drupal 8. Jadi, adakah yang bisa mengarahkan saya ke arah yang benar untuk melakukan ini? Saya …
32 taxonomy-terms  8 

7
Bagaimana saya membungkam kesalahan PHP?
Apakah ada cara untuk membungkam semua kesalahan, peringatan, dan pemberitahuan PHP di Drupal? Mereka berguna di situs devel tetapi mereka adalah risiko keamanan yang besar, dan membuat situs tampak buruk di siaran langsung. Saya tahu pada Drupal 6 halaman di admin / pengaturan / pelaporan kesalahan dapat menghentikan Drupal dari …
32 7 

5
Apakah saya memerlukan tugas cron untuk memproses antrian?
Saya punya tugas yang membutuhkan waktu sekitar 45 menit untuk diselesaikan dan perlu terjadi setiap hari (menyinkronkan pengguna ke beberapa basis data eksternal, dll). Untuk menangani pekerjaan, saya telah menyiapkan antrian cron dengan hook_cron_queue_info()sebagai berikut: function mymodule_cron_queue_info() { $queues = array(); $queues['update_users_queue'] = array( 'worker callback' => '_mymodule_process_user_queue_item', 'time' => …
32 7  hooks  cron  queue 


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.